Are You a Suitable Prospect for Surgery?



Just how do you know if you're an ideal prospect for vision correction surgery? First, consider your age; most surgeons suggest going to the very least 18 years old. You should also have a stable prescription for at the very least a year.

Next off, examine your overall eye health and wellness. Conditions like cataracts or severe dry eye can invalidate you. If you're expecting or nursing, it's finest to wait up until after.

In addition, think about your way of living; energetic individuals could need to discuss specific sports-related concerns.

It's vital to consult with an eye professional that can perform a detailed analysis and review your distinct circumstance. They'll help identify if you fulfill the requirements for surgery and if it aligns with your vision goals.

What Are the Prospective Dangers and Adverse Effects?



While vision correction surgical treatment can offer substantial advantages, it is very important to recognize the possible threats and side effects included.



Issues can include dry eyes, glare, halos, or perhaps vision loss in unusual instances. You might experience discomfort or variations in your vision throughout the recovery process, which can be irritating.

It's likewise feasible that you won't achieve the preferred vision renovation or may still need glasses later. Additionally, some patients report long term adjustments to their new vision.

Maintaining these risks in mind can assist you make a more enlightened choice. Always review your worry about your doctor, who can supply thorough information tailored to your details circumstance and help you weigh the advantages and disadvantages successfully.

What Are the Long-Term Implications of Vision Improvement Surgical Treatment?



Are you gotten ready for the lasting effects of vision improvement surgical treatment? While numerous take pleasure in improved vision, it's essential to think about potential lasting effects.

You might experience adjustments in your vision gradually, such as halos or glare, particularly in the evening. Some patients report dry eyes, which could require recurring administration.

Though the surgery can reduce your dependancy on glasses or contacts, it doesn't guarantee perfect vision forever. You might still need glasses for certain jobs as you age.
